Explain what royal dynasty in ancient Egypt was

Respuesta :

secnav02 secnav02
  • 01-10-2018
In Ancient Egyptian history, dynasties are series of rulers sharing a common origin. They are usually, but not always, of the same family. Ancient Egypt's historical period is traditionally divided into thirty-two pharaonic dynasties.
